A set of predicates and assertions for checking the properties of US-specific complex data types. This is mainly for use by other package developers who want to include run-time testing features in their own packages. End-users will usually want to use assertive directly.
A set of predicates and assertions for checking the properties of US-specific complex data types. Most of the documentation is on the assertive page. End-users will usually want to use assertive directly.
To install the stable version, type:
install.packages("assertive.data.us")To install the development version, you first need the devtools package.
install.packages("devtools")Then you can install the assertive.data.us package using
library(devtools)install_bitbucket("richierocks/assertive.data.us")is_us_telephone_number checks character vectors for UK telephone numbers.
is_uk_zipcode checks character vectors for UK zip codes.
Predicates all return a vector and have two corresponding assertions. For example,
is_us_telephone_number has assert_all_are_us_telephone_numbers and assert_any_are_us_telephone_numbers.
0.0-2 Drop dependency on devtools::with_envvar(). 0.0-1 Content extracted from assertive 0.3-0, and tidied.